Understanding the webM and MP4 Formats

webM is an open, royalty-free media file format designed primarily for web video, using the VP8 or VP9 video codec and Vorbis or Opus audio codecs. It excels in compression efficiency, particularly for high-definition content, which keeps file sizes smaller for online streaming. MP4, based on the ISO/IEC 14496 standard, is a container format that can hold video, audio, and subtitles. It typically uses the H.264 or H.265 video codec, providing excellent compatibility with hardware players, streaming services, and social media platforms.
Why Compatibility Matters

While modern browsers handle webM smoothly, many environments still default to MP4. Email clients, corporate intranets, older mobile devices, and certain video editing applications may fail to play webM files. Converting to MP4 removes these barriers, ensuring your video reaches the widest possible audience without requiring specific browser extensions or updated software.

Desktop Software
For frequent converters or large files, desktop applications offer speed, batch processing, and advanced control. Programs like HandBrake, VLC Media Player, and FFmpeg allow you to convert webM to MP4 while adjusting codecs, bitrates, and resolution. This method keeps your data local, which is crucial for confidential projects.

Batch Conversion and Automation




















Handling multiple files individually is inefficient. Many converters support batch processing, letting you convert an entire folder of webM files to MP4 in one go. Advanced users can automate workflows with command-line tools like FFmpeg, creating scripts that monitor folders and convert new uploads automatically. This approach is ideal for media teams and developers managing large libraries of video assets.
